Rugby Union in Spain

Rugby union in Spain is a growing team sport. There are 27,572 registered players in Spain, 1,567 of whom are female. There are 221 clubs playing in various divisions.

The Spanish Rugby Federation (Spanish: FederaciĆ³n EspaƱola de Rugby), based in Madrid, is the governing body for the sport of rugby union in Spain. It was founded in 1923, and joined the International Rugby Board in 1988. It is also a member of FIRA.

The Spanish national team plays in the European Nations Cup, a competition for second tier European rugby nations such as Portugal and Russia. Spain is ranked 23rd in the world, and played at the 1999 Rugby World Cup. The national sevens team is now one of the 15 "core teams" that participate in each event of the annual IRB Sevens World Series, having earned that status at the 2012 Hong Kong Sevens.
